Transaction

efeea57136f96cab40efc1410aedd11acfd7fc7a8a28db76a4e23b910fd8ecb7
296,647 confirmations
Timestamp
1594801550
Block639,345
Fee380,244 sats
Fee rate42.1 sats/vB
view on mempool.space

Inputs & Outputs

Inputs